Lore of metal is simply more versatile in terms of its ultimate spell. The hounds stay for a long time; they act as a vortex spell and are capable of murdering a lot of enemy troops (which is sort of important if you will ever decide to storm one of the two super keeps: Brass Citadel or Blood Keep). But this lore lacks heal, if that is important to you (personally, I always hire Damsel or Life Mage to fill that role).
